WebThe Toyota Hybrid battery can last 14-15 years without maintenance. The Hybrid battery doesn’t require any special maintenance. Unlike the Tesla High voltage battery, which is liquid-cooled, the Toyota Hybrid battery is air-cooled. There’s only a fan and air filter. WebYour hybrid battery will likely last between 10 and 15 years. I won’t keep you in suspense. Most hybrid batteries last 10 – 15 years. Mileage seems to be unimportant. We’ve replaced batteries on 12 year old hybrids with only 45K miles, and seen good original batteries on hybrids with 300K+ on the clock. In the early days I tried very hard ...

WebAverage hybrid battery lifespan. Car manufacturers are required to warranty a hybrid battery for at least eight years or 100,000 miles, whichever comes first, according to federal law. Some warranties are even 10 years. However, that isn’t necessarily the battery’s lifespan. It’s possible for a battery to fail before that time or mileage ...
